NettetIf you are a non-exempt employee in California, you must be given a minimum 30-minute lunch or meal break if you work more than 5 hours in a day. The meal break can be unpaid time, and it must start before the end of the fifth hour of the workday.. Employees who work more than ten (10) hours during a day are entitled to a second 30-minute … Nettet20. jul. 2024 · Breaks Between Shifts. Maryland-retail establishment employees who work a consecutive four- to … NettetAn employee must not work for more than five hours in a row without getting a 30-minute eating period (meal break) free from work. However, if the employer and employee agree, the eating period can be split into two eating periods within every five consecutive hours. Together these must total at least 30 minutes.
